Horrible experience! First off we waited for 20 minutes for someone to come over and great us ,which was the Manger. She apologies for the wait and brings us menus which I asked for a gluten free one due to my allergy. She brings it over and I decide to order the lemon roll and my friend orders the salmon curry soup. We wait literally a hour for our food! Mind you we are on our lunch break and though a sushi roll and soup would be the quicker option. Lol wrong. I'm fine with waiting if it's worth the wait. Our food comes out and I take a bite of the shushi and notice it doesn't have shrimp in it but instead crab. Which I know wasnt stated on the gluten free menu. So I ask the server to find out if the was a mistake as I know imitation crab meat is not gluten free. He comes back over as says yes they made it wrong and it is not gluten free! I told him I already ate one. Mind you I am very sensitive to gluten and get really sick. I only eat athe like 2 places because of stuff like this. I get up and go find the manager lady and tell her never mind on the roll and I will just take the pho thinking it will be safer. She bring out the pho and apologized for the mistake which my friend tells her ,she's going to get sick from that and the manager says I hope not , which I reply No I'm going to be sick for sure but no worries. I eat my pho with worries about if it's really gluten free or not. Then when time to pay they bring over the checks and charge me for the pho! No discount or anything! WHAT! I work in the restaurant industry and would never charge anyone after knowing we made the sick because of our mistake! All they had to do was follow their OWN gluten free menu when making the roll. I took the check to the blonde hair manager and told her there should be some kind of discount for the mess up as knowing I'm going to be sick tomorrow. She saus well if that's the way you feel I will just take care of the bill. THAT'S THE WAY YOU SHOULD FEEL AS THE MANAGER! !! I continue to try and talk to her about the situation and she cuts me off while speaking and says that's why I said I would take care of the bill. That bill should of never come to my table to begin with. She was rude and had no concern as to me getting sick from their mistake. I'm writingthis review a day after and I am sick. Had to take off work today. It took 2 hours from start to finish to get lunch and also got sick and they wanted me to pay for that. DONT HAVE A GLUTEN FREE MENU IF YOU DON'T GO BY IT. PEOPLE...

Luke provided excellent service to us on our first visit. The Thai Green Curry sounded great to me, but once we told Luke that I was vegetarian he went ahead and followed up with the chef. Turns out that a component of the dish (even if you get the tofu protein) might involve chicken broth. If I had no other option in a pinch, I would overlook this detail - but Luke came back not only with that information but with the vegan menu. I went with the Spicy Udon instead, because I like to let restaurants know with my vote that there are patrons like me who value fully non-meat options. The Spicy Udon did not disappoint- I don't have a high spice tolerance but this was just enough to be pleasant. Hubby had the Pad Thai, which he can never resist if it's on a menu, and he was happy with it. Just know that they didn't ask for spice level, so it's not THAT kind of spicy thrill some seek, but he said his was flavourful nonetheless. We also ordered a sushi roll as an appetizer- Super Crunch Roll - and we were pleasantly surprised. It tasted fresh, and itself had a great taste profile along with the sauce it comes with (I always forget to take a picture of the first element of a meal - if it's good, I'm inspired to write a review, so this was that inspiring element!) For drinks, I enjoyed the punch my Nigori Peach Martini had in store, while the hubby's Blackberry Bourbon Fizz was so smooth, it was like having a light soda. We don't normally do desert, but I was curious about the strawberry cheesecake wonton. The strawberries were so fresh it made me tear a little with the combination of the cheesecake and sauce. Easily sharable between two without feeling guilty about overeating. We had a great experience. Ambiance was great and the support staff was also very attentive and polite. Thank you for a great evening meal out!

My wife found CO while searching Google for vegan dining options near our hotel in Myrtle Beach, SC. I guess if we were staunch activists we wouldn't dare set foot in a place that served raw seafood, or animal meat of any kind, but we enjoy dining out at cool restaurants, especially if they offer vegan options. Aside from their main sushi fare, CO has a complete menu of vegan-only offerings including some very good maki, temaki, pressed sushi, makimono, as well as noodle and rice dishes. We over-ordered because we wanted to try so many things on the menu, even so there wasn't much left behind when we were finished. Everything was wonderful. My wife ordered all of the small plates: steamed Lemongrass Tofu Buns, Edamame Spring Rolls and the Avocado Ceviche. She wanted to sample it all, but couldn't eat everything so I helped. No worries there. I always seem to have extra room. I ordered Cucumber Maki for an appetizer and Hibachi Deluxe for my meal, followed by an order of Kanpyo Maki. As I said, extra room. We had one pot each of Chai Tea and Green Tea to wash it down. It was a temperate evening so we dined outside at a corner pup table. Our server Lee was pleasant, unassuming and very helpful. In all we enjoyed CO Sushi very much. Highly recommended if you're in Myrtle Beach and looking for a nice place to dine. It's right next door to the movie theater too so make it a dinner and movie night.
